{"heading":"Understanding the Science Behind the Blood Moon","subheading":"Rayleigh Scattering and Atmospheric Conditions","content":["The phenomenon of a partial lunar eclipse turning the moon into a 'blood red' celestial display is primarily due to Rayleigh scattering, where sunlight passing through Earth's atmosphere loses shorter blue wavelengths while longer red and orange wavelengths bend toward the Moon.","Atmospheric conditions also play a crucial role in amplifying the deep copper-red tone projected onto the lunar disk during peak shadow alignment.","Dust and clouds within Earth's atmosphere contribute to this effect, enhancing the visual impact of the event."]}
